summaryrefslogtreecommitdiff
path: root/giffeinate
diff options
context:
space:
mode:
Diffstat (limited to 'giffeinate')
-rwxr-xr-xgiffeinate22
1 files changed, 0 insertions, 22 deletions
diff --git a/giffeinate b/giffeinate
deleted file mode 100755
index 8e59600..0000000
--- a/giffeinate
+++ /dev/null
@@ -1,22 +0,0 @@
-#!/bin/sh
-
-# Turn video files on STDIN into animated GIFs.
-
-FPS=${FPS:-10}
-SCALE=${SCALE:-480}
-
-while [ $1 ]
-do
- BASENAME=$(echo $1 | cut -d'.' -f1)
- FRAMEDIR=/tmp/$BASENAME-frames-$(date +%s)
-
- mkdir -p $FRAMEDIR
- echo Writing frames...
- ffmpeg -loglevel quiet -i $1 -vf scale=-1:$SCALE,fps=$FPS $FRAMEDIR/%05d.png
- echo Creating GIF...
- convert -loop 0 $FRAMEDIR/*.png $BASENAME.gif
- rm -r $FRAMEDIR
- echo Done.
- shift
-done
-